Banks and Personal Wealth Management
ABA SELF-PACED ONLINE TRAINING
Guides you through managing the customers’ personal financial assets. See the active role banks play in their communities by growing assets. Explore the services banks may offer for financial planning and wealth management. Discover trust and investment products and services that meet many financial needs.
Duration: Approximately 10 minutes.
Audience: For Onboarding. Anyone who needs an introduction to banking, whether just starting a career in the industry or a more experienced professional from a different industry, including specialists in non-banking functions such as marketing, information systems, and human resources.
Learning Objectives:
- Explain financial planning tools and process
- Describe insurance and investment products that banks offer
- Define retirement planning considerations and products
- Explain the laws, regulations, and expectations for banks and bankers engaged in providing investment, insurance and trust services
